The MILWAUKEE ATC34 is a close quarter tubing cutter designed for cutting copper, brass, and thin-wall tubing in tight spaces where a standard cutter cannot fit. Built for plumbers, HVAC technicians, and pipefitters working in confined areas such as wall cavities, under cabinets, and mechanical rooms, this tool delivers clean, burr-minimal cuts without the swing clearance required by conventional cutters. The compact head design allows the cutter to reach pipe runs that would otherwise require costly access cuts or rerouting. At 8.6 pounds, the ATC34 is a field-ready tool suited to daily trade use.
The ATC34 is used in residential and light commercial plumbing and HVAC applications wherever 3/4 inch tubing is installed in restricted locations. Typical scenarios include copper water supply lines behind fixtures, refrigerant line sets in tight chases, and hydronic piping near structural members. This cutter is a practical solution when space constraints make standard tubing cutters impractical on the job site.

Shut off the water supply or isolate the refrigerant circuit before cutting any active line. Ensure the tubing is properly supported on both sides of the cut to prevent deformation. Deburr the cut end before making any flared, swaged, or press-fit connection. Follow applicable plumbing and mechanical codes, including IPC and IFGC requirements, for the jurisdiction where work is performed.
